Surgical treatment and reproductive outcomes in caesarean scar pregnancy at a single center
Abstract Background To investigate factors associated with different reproductive outcomes in patients with Caesarean scar pregnancies (CSPs). Methods Between May 2017 and July 2022, 549 patients underwent ultrasound-guided uterine aspiration and laparoscopic scar repair at the Gynaecology Departmen...
